And you do realize that the Malthusian doom prophecy has fallen out of favor in development, health and demography about 20 years ago?
The problem is less to do with the idea of overpopulation but more resource allocation and energy. Thus you whole air conditioning thing. How are they powered? Who builds them? Disposal and so on.
This is also something that is heavily researched. How we produce energy over the next 30 to 50 years is huge. Food and sustainability is huge. But to say the world, with its slowing growth rate which may turn negative thanks is doomed from over pop right now is both premature and not supported in the literature.

First China's political machine is as bad or worse than the Japanese in the early 1990's. Any belief otherwise is drinking China's kool aid. They have issues with corruption that match or beat Russia depending on province.
The robust economic growth is not because of the one child policy it is because they had a vast production ability that had been completely dismantled under Mao and was rebuilt under Deng and not without huge cost. The rapid inflation in the 1980's almost lead to a collapse of the Chinese government. See Tianmen and it economic underpinnings and read up on Guangxi or listen to Ronya and I discuss Singapore verse Taiwan and China.
Their growth compared to their other neighbors who have had similar governments like Taiwan and SK till the mid 1990's is not awe inspiring or Japan in at the turn of the 20th century. It in fact matches a very similar pattern.
China on the surface is great. Once you get deeper into it is a broken political system and an economic growth that is unsustainable and that is worse than reported and produced incredible amounts of inequality between groups. See their GINI index for the last year.
